The presence of any of these crystals in a dog’s urine may indicate liver disease or … WebCrystals in dog urine usually form from minerals that are normally present in your dog’s urine. The presence of the crystals is determined by factors such as pH, temperature, and urine concentration (also known as urine specific gravity). Some crystals form in acidic urine (pH < 7.0) while others form in alkaline urine (pH > 7.0).

WebNov 5, 2024 · Calcium oxalate crystals are found in acid urine of dogs (pH lower than 6.5) with high levels of calcium in the blood. They are most commonly found in the bladder and less often in the dog's upper urinary tract.
